Australia New Zealand Internet Awards

Date: July / 04 / 2011
InternetNZ (Internet New Zealand Inc) and .au Domain Administration (auDA) are proud to announce The 2011 Australia and New Zealand Internet Awards (ANZIAs) have opened for entries today.

The ANZIAs are open to businesses, organisations and individuals across all sectors that use the Internet to develop innovative and creative ways to reach customers, provide a service or improve the online experiences of Australians and New Zealanders.

NetHui2011 opens today

Date: June / 29 / 2011
Wednesday 29th June, 2011

Today was the first day for the NetHui2011. NetHui 2011 is a conference that brings together everyone involved with Internet issues in New Zealand. The inaugural NetHui2011 will be held over three days from 29 June – 1 July 2011 at the Sky City Convention Centre in Auckland.

Rural broadband to benefit Maori communities

Date: May / 05 / 2011
Maori Affairs Minister Dr Pita Sharples and Minister for Communications and Information Technology Steven Joyce today announced the establishment of a Maori Working Group to help steer the rollout of the government's Rural Broadband Initiative (RBI).
